System and method for preparing near-surface heavy oil for extraction using microbial degradation

Patent ·
OSTI ID:1016803
A system and method for enhancing the recovery of heavy oil in an oil extraction environment by feeding nutrients to a preferred microbial species (bacteria and/or fungi). A method is described that includes the steps of: sampling and identifying microbial species that reside in the oil extraction environment; collecting fluid property data from the oil extraction environment; collecting nutrient data from the oil extraction environment; identifying a preferred microbial species from the oil extraction environment that can transform the heavy oil into a lighter oil; identifying a nutrient from the oil extraction environment that promotes a proliferation of the preferred microbial species; and introducing the nutrient into the oil extraction environment.
